summ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Ricardo Signes <rjbs@cpan.org>2015-11-13 11:27:56 -0500
committerRicardo Signes <rjbs@cpan.org>2015-11-13 11:27:56 -0500
commitfa8ba16d2ec24f8e078935885234ce273a6a82c6 (patch)
tree9ff87c8939053afae8daa08f857da9af31e78eee
parent48d0e2b20bba278a1927e100c7d907bff0ed360b (diff)
downloadperl-fa8ba16d2ec24f8e078935885234ce273a6a82c6.tar.gz
base: no longer works on v5.6, require v5.8
-rw-r--r--dist/base/Changes5
-rw-r--r--dist/base/Makefile.PL1
-rw-r--r--dist/base/lib/base.pm5
-rw-r--r--dist/base/lib/fields.pm4
4 files changed, 12 insertions, 3 deletions
diff --git a/dist/base/Changes b/dist/base/Changes
index 2de35bb4d7..c4cbb18995 100644
--- a/dist/base/Changes
+++ b/dist/base/Changes
@@ -1,3 +1,8 @@
+2.22_01
+ - require perl v5.8.0; tests for [perl #121196] break on 5.6.1, and
+ I (rjbs) am not comfortable spending time determining whether the fault
+ lies for a 15 year old version of perl
+
2.22
- Better handling of attempts to load non-existent modules
- Improvements to fields.pm documentation
diff --git a/dist/base/Makefile.PL b/dist/base/Makefile.PL
index a62b968cb3..3ae42441fc 100644
--- a/dist/base/Makefile.PL
+++ b/dist/base/Makefile.PL
@@ -1,3 +1,4 @@
+use 5.008;
use strict;
use ExtUtils::MakeMaker;
diff --git a/dist/base/lib/base.pm b/dist/base/lib/base.pm
index 5d1378786d..7eff8b2c58 100644
--- a/dist/base/lib/base.pm
+++ b/dist/base/lib/base.pm
@@ -1,9 +1,10 @@
+use 5.008;
package base;
use strict 'vars';
use vars qw($VERSION);
-$VERSION = '2.22';
-$VERSION = eval $VERSION;
+$VERSION = '2.22_01';
+$VERSION =~ tr/_//d;
# constant.pm is slow
sub SUCCESS () { 1 }
diff --git a/dist/base/lib/fields.pm b/dist/base/lib/fields.pm
index ad1a5cfa41..630f8cef2b 100644
--- a/dist/base/lib/fields.pm
+++ b/dist/base/lib/fields.pm
@@ -1,3 +1,4 @@
+use 5.008;
package fields;
require 5.005;
@@ -11,7 +12,8 @@ unless( eval q{require warnings::register; warnings::register->import; 1} ) {
}
use vars qw(%attr $VERSION);
-$VERSION = '2.17';
+$VERSION = '2.22_01';
+$VERSION =~ tr/_//d;
# constant.pm is slow
sub PUBLIC () { 2**0 }